U.S. Education Department issues report on anti-bullying laws

Dec. 7, 2011
46 states now have anti-bullying laws

News release: Forty-one states have created anti-bullying policies as models for schools, the U.S. Education Department says. The finding was included in Analysis of State Bullying Laws and Policies, a report summarizing current approaches in the 46 states that have anti-bullying laws. Of the 46 states with anti-bullying laws in place, 36 have provisions that prohibit cyber bullying and 13 have statutes that grant schools the authority to address off-campus behavior that creates a hostile school environment.
